What is an Lcl?

An LCL (Less-than-Container Load) job typically involves coordinating and managing shipments that do not fill an entire shipping container. Professionals in this role work in logistics and freight forwarding, ensuring that multiple shipments from different customers are efficiently consolidated. Responsibilities may include tracking shipments, handling documentation, and communicating with clients and carriers. This job requires strong organizational skills and attention to detail to ensure smooth and cost-effective transportation.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Lcl position?

To thrive as an LCL (Less-than-Container Load) Coordinator or Specialist, you need a solid understanding of logistics, international shipping regulations, and supply chain management, typically supported by experience or education in transportation or logistics. Familiarity with freight management systems, cargo tracking software, and industry certifications such as IATA or FIATA is highly valuable. Str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and effective communication are essential soft skills for coordinating shipments and liaising with various stakeholders. These skills are crucial to ensure efficient cargo consolidation, timely delivery, and high customer satisfaction in a complex logistics environment.

What are some typical challenges faced by Lcl coordinators in the logistics industry?

LCL Coordinators often encounter challenges such as managing tight shipping deadlines, handling last-minute changes in cargo schedules, and ensuring compliance with diverse international regulations. Coordination between multiple parties—including shippers, carriers, and consignees—requires constant attention to detail and proactive communication. Additionally, responding to disruptions like customs delays or equipment shortages is a common part of the job. These challenges make adaptability and problem-solving skills essential for success, and also provide opportunities to build expertise in international logistics and enhance your career prospects.

Booz Allen Hamilton is a leading provider of management and technology consulting services to the US government in defense, intelligence, and civil markets. Headquartered in McLean, Virginia, the firm also serves major corporations, institutions, and not-for-profit organizations. Founded in 1914 by Edwin G. Booz, the company has a long-standing tradition of helping clients achieve success by delivering a wide range of consulting services that include strategic planning, human capital and learning, communication, systems development, and others. The company's mission is to empower people to change the world, and it has a reputation for maintaining the highest standards of integrity and-excellence.
